Ingredients (Serves 2–3)

  • 500 g large prawns, peeled and deveined

  • 1 tbsp olive oil

  • 1½ tbsp garlic, finely minced

  • 1–2 red chilies, finely chopped (adjust to taste)

  • 1 tbsp lemon juice

  • 1 tsp smoked paprika

  • ½ tsp black pepper

  • ½ tsp chili flakes (optional)

  • Salt to taste

  • Fresh parsley or coriander, chopped (for garnish)


How to Make BBQ Chilli Garlic Prawns

Step 1: Marinate the Prawns

In a bowl, combine olive oil, garlic, chilies, lemon juice, smoked paprika, black pepper, chili flakes, and salt. Add prawns and toss until evenly coated. Marinate for 10–15 minutes.

Step 2: Preheat the BBQ or Grill

Heat your BBQ grill or grill pan to medium-high. Lightly oil the grates to prevent sticking.

Step 3: Grill the Prawns

Place prawns on the hot grill. Cook for 2–3 minutes per side until they turn pink and slightly charred.

Step 4: Garnish & Serve

Remove from heat, sprinkle with fresh herbs, and serve immediately.


Serving Suggestions

  • Pair with grilled vegetables or a fresh green salad

  • Serve over brown rice or quinoa for a balanced meal

  • Enjoy as a healthy appetizer with lemon wedges


Tips for Extra Flavor & Nutrition

  • Use fresh garlic instead of garlic powder for maximum aroma

  • Add a splash of low-sodium soy sauce for umami depth

  • Brush lightly with olive oil while grilling to keep prawns juicy
